Job Summary:

The Adjunct Faculty (HRLY) is responsible for developing curriculum and presenting instruction in computer applications.

Examples: MS Outlook, MS Word, MS Excel, MS Power Point



Essential Functions:

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.







· Provides professional instruction based on approved course syllabus.

Ensures that desired course outcomes meet the stated objectives

60%
· Prepares curriculum and syllabus to coursework taught



20%
· Evaluates students’ progress at attaining goals and objectives

5%
· Ensures safety and security requirements are met in training areas

5%
· Meets with students, staff members, supervisors as needed

5%
Other Duties as Assigned

(5%)





Competencies:

· Skill in developing lesson outlines and materials

· Knowledge of vocational area of assignment

· Skill in presenting subject matter

· Skill in use of computers and job-related software programs

· Skill in interpersonal relations and dealing with adult learners

· Oral and written communication



Work Environment:

This job operates in a professional office environment.

This role routinely uses standard office equipment and technologies.



Physical Demands:

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.





While performing the duties of this job, the employee is occasionally required to stand, walk; sit; use hands to finger, handle or feel objects, tools, or controls; reach with hands and arms; climb stairs; talk or hear.

The employee must occasionally lift or move office products and supplies, up to 25 pounds.





Position Type/Expected Hours of Work:

This is a part-time instructional position.



Travel:

Travel to other campuses is a possibility for training



Required Education and Experience:

· Minimum qualifications for this position are extensive knowledge and experience in the subject matter.



· Can provide and use workplace scenarios to enhance participants learning.



· Experience in actual day-to-day duties and can use examples to boost productivity of participants.



· Note : Experience may substitute for the degree on a year-for-year basis.





Preferred Education and Experience:

· Bachelor’s degree;

· Minimum three (3) years’ experience in post‐secondary education, faculty recruiting, or

related field;

· Teaching Experience on the post‐Secondary Level;

· Strong computer, communication, and interpersonal skills;

    Here are some tips to help you prepare for and ace your job interview:

    Before the Interview:
    • Research: Learn about the State of Georgia's mission, values, products, and the specific job requirements and get further information about
    • Other Openings
    • Practice: Prepare answers to common interview questions and rehearse using the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to showcase your skills and experiences.
    • Dress Professionally: Choose attire appropriate for the company culture.
    • Prepare Questions: Show your interest by having thoughtful questions for the interviewer.
    • Plan Your Commute: Allow ample time to arrive on time and avoid feeling rushed.
    During the Interview:
    • Be Punctual: Arrive on time to demonstrate professionalism and respect.
    • Make a Great First Impression: Greet the interviewer with a handshake, smile, and eye contact.
    • Confidence and Enthusiasm: Project a positive attitude and show your genuine interest in the opportunity.
    • Answer Thoughtfully: Listen carefully, take a moment to formulate clear and concise responses. Highlight relevant skills and experiences using the STAR method.
    • Ask Prepared Questions: Demonstrate curiosity and engagement with the role and company.
    • Follow Up: Send a thank-you email to the interviewer within 24 hours.
    Additional Tips:
    • Be Yourself: Let your personality shine through while maintaining professionalism.
    • Be Honest: Don't exaggerate your skills or experience.
    • Be Positive: Focus on your strengths and accomplishments.
    • Body Language: Maintain good posture, avoid fidgeting, and make eye contact.
    • Turn Off Phone: Avoid distractions during the interview.
